I always pronounced it "roth" but my dictionary has two options:

roth (with the 'o' as in hot) or rawth with the 'aw' as in 'saw'. The first one is the most common, apparently.

It does mention the Old English derivation which is pronounced the way BB are doing it (with the 'a' as in 'cat') but that's just a technicality
